Tips for Purchasing Lavatory Furnishings in Portland, Oregon

Selecting appropriate cabinetry and countertops for a lavatory renovation requires careful consideration. The following tips provide guidance for navigating the purchasing process within the Portland, Oregon market.

Tip 1: Assess Spatial Constraints: Accurate measurements of the available space are crucial. Account for plumbing locations, door swing, and adequate clearance for movement. This prevents selection of oversized units.

Tip 2: Establish a Budget: Determine a financial limit before initiating the search. Factor in not only the cost of the unit itself but also delivery, installation, and any necessary plumbing modifications. This avoids overspending.

Tip 3: Research Local Suppliers: Investigate various retailers and custom fabricators operating within the Portland metropolitan area. Compare pricing, product lines, and customer reviews to identify reputable sources.

Tip 4: Prioritize Material Durability: Select materials resistant to moisture, humidity, and staining. Options such as quartz countertops and sealed wood cabinets provide longevity and ease of maintenance.

Tip 5: Evaluate Storage Needs: Consider the required storage capacity. Drawers, shelves, and integrated organizers contribute to efficient utilization of space and decluttered surfaces. Tailor the selection to the specific requirements of the lavatory’s occupants.

Tip 6: Confirm Installation Procedures: Inquire about the supplier’s installation services or recommendations for qualified plumbers and contractors. Proper installation ensures functionality and prevents potential water damage.

Tip 7: Review Warranty Coverage: Examine the warranty provided by the manufacturer or supplier. Understand the terms and conditions, including the duration of coverage and the process for making a claim. This protects against defects in materials or workmanship.

Adhering to these recommendations facilitates an informed purchasing decision, resulting in a functional and aesthetically pleasing lavatory space. Attention to detail throughout the selection process minimizes the potential for costly errors and ensures long-term satisfaction.

2. Material Selection

2. Material Selection, Portland

The material composition of lavatory furnishings profoundly impacts their durability, aesthetics, and overall suitability for the humid environment typical of bathrooms. Therefore, the selection of appropriate materials is a critical consideration for those acquiring these furnishings in the Portland, Oregon, region. The Pacific Northwest climate, characterized by significant rainfall and humidity, necessitates materials resistant to moisture damage, mold growth, and warping. Failure to consider this factor leads to premature degradation of the furnishings and costly repairs or replacements.

Specific material choices exhibit varying levels of performance under these environmental conditions. For instance, solid hardwood, while aesthetically appealing, requires meticulous sealing and maintenance to prevent water damage. Conversely, engineered wood products such as plywood or MDF, when properly sealed with moisture-resistant coatings, offer a more stable and cost-effective alternative. Countertop materials also demand careful evaluation. Quartz, granite, and solid surface materials provide excellent resistance to staining, scratching, and moisture penetration, making them suitable choices for lavatory surfaces. Laminate countertops, while more affordable, are susceptible to water damage if not properly sealed or maintained.

In conclusion, material selection constitutes a fundamental aspect of acquiring lavatory furnishings in the Portland, Oregon, area. The region’s climate demands a focus on moisture resistance and durability. Understanding the properties of various materials and their suitability for the lavatory environment minimizes the risk of premature deterioration and ensures the long-term performance and aesthetic appeal of the chosen furnishings. Prioritizing appropriate material choices represents a prudent investment, preventing future expenses associated with repairs or replacements.

3. Space Optimization

3. Space Optimization, Portland

The dimensions of lavatories, particularly in older Portland residences, often present challenges for maximizing functionality. Selection of cabinetry and countertops necessitates a strategic approach to space utilization. Inadequate consideration of spatial constraints leads to cramped conditions, impeding movement and diminishing the usability of the room. Conversely, thoughtful planning transforms limited square footage into efficient and comfortable environments.

The correlation between spatial dimensions and fixture selection is readily apparent. Wall-mounted fixtures, for example, free up floor space, creating the illusion of greater size. Corner units, similarly, capitalize on otherwise underutilized areas. Customized storage solutions, such as recessed shelving or vertical organizers, maximize vertical space. One might consider a Portland condo with a narrow lavatory. A standard-depth vanity would obstruct movement. Implementing a wall-mounted, shallow-depth unit resolves this issue, improving maneuverability and storage capacity.

Strategic space planning is integral to successful remodeling or new construction involving lavatory furnishings. Attention to detail regarding fixture dimensions, storage solutions, and layout optimizes the available area. Ignoring this critical component results in compromised functionality and a less desirable outcome. Therefore, careful consideration of spatial dimensions and innovative storage solutions is paramount when selecting cabinetry and countertops in Portland, Oregon, ensuring comfort and efficiency within the lavatory environment.

4. Installation Requirements

4. Installation Requirements, Portland

Proper installation is essential for the longevity and functionality of lavatory furnishings in Portland, Oregon. Installation considerations extend beyond mere placement; they encompass adherence to local building codes, plumbing standards, and electrical safety regulations. Failure to meet these requirements can result in property damage, code violations, and potential hazards.

  • Plumbing Connections

    Accurate connection of water supply lines and drainage pipes is crucial. Improper connections lead to leaks, water damage, and potential mold growth. In Portland, plumbing installations must comply with the Oregon Plumbing Specialty Code, requiring licensed professionals for specific tasks. For example, a vanity with integrated sinks necessitates proper drainpipe alignment to prevent clogs and water backups, often requiring adjustments to existing plumbing infrastructure.

  • Electrical Wiring

    If the chosen cabinetry includes integrated lighting or electrical outlets, adherence to electrical codes is imperative. Improper wiring poses a fire hazard and violates safety regulations. Portland’s electrical code mandates grounding of electrical fixtures and the use of appropriate wiring gauges. Consider a vanity with built-in lighting; a qualified electrician must ensure compliance with code requirements to prevent electrical shocks or fire hazards.

  • Structural Support

    The weight of the lavatory furnishings, especially those with stone countertops, requires adequate structural support. Insufficient support causes sagging, instability, and potential damage to the surrounding walls or flooring. Portland building codes specify load-bearing requirements for wall-mounted and floor-mounted fixtures. For example, a heavy granite countertop necessitates reinforcement of the wall studs to prevent collapse or detachment of the vanity.

  • Ventilation

    Proper ventilation is essential for preventing moisture buildup, mold growth, and damage to the cabinetry. Adequate ventilation reduces humidity levels, protecting the materials from deterioration. Portland’s building codes stipulate ventilation requirements for lavatories, often necessitating the installation of exhaust fans. Without proper ventilation, moisture from showers and sinks condenses on the surfaces, leading to warping, peeling, and mold infestation.

These installation requirements are integral to the long-term performance of lavatory furnishings in Portland, Oregon. Compliance with local codes, professional installation, and proper material selection mitigate the risks of property damage and safety hazards. Neglecting these considerations leads to costly repairs and potential code violations, highlighting the importance of engaging qualified professionals and adhering to established building standards.

Frequently Asked Questions

The following addresses common inquiries regarding the selection and acquisition of lavatory cabinetry and countertops within the Portland, Oregon area. These questions aim to provide clarity on crucial considerations for homeowners and contractors involved in lavatory renovation or new construction projects.

Question 1: What are the typical dimensions for lavatory cabinetry suitable for compact Portland bungalows?

Answer: Standard depth vanities (21-24 inches) are often unsuitable for smaller spaces. Solutions include wall-mounted units, custom-built shallow-depth vanities (15-18 inches), or corner configurations to optimize available space and improve maneuverability.

Question 2: How does the climate in Portland, Oregon, affect the choice of countertop materials for lavatory spaces?

Answer: The humid climate necessitates moisture-resistant materials. Quartz, granite, and solid-surface countertops offer superior resistance to water damage compared to laminate or wood, minimizing the risk of mold growth and material degradation.

Question 3: What considerations are paramount when selecting local suppliers of lavatory furnishings in Portland?

Answer: Factors include proximity for consultations and deliveries, responsiveness to customer inquiries, reputation based on online reviews, and the availability of custom fabrication options to accommodate unique spatial requirements or design preferences.

Question 4: Are there specific building code requirements that apply to the installation of lavatory cabinetry and plumbing in Portland?

Answer: Yes. The Oregon Plumbing Specialty Code governs plumbing installations, requiring licensed professionals for specific tasks. Electrical wiring must adhere to the Oregon Electrical Code, mandating grounding and proper wiring gauges for integrated lighting or outlets.

Question 5: How can homeowners ensure proper ventilation in a Portland lavatory to prevent moisture damage?

Answer: Compliance with Portland building codes typically requires the installation of an exhaust fan vented to the exterior. Regular use of the exhaust fan during and after showering or bathing reduces humidity levels, minimizing the risk of mold growth and material degradation.

Question 6: What are some popular design trends influencing the selection of lavatory furnishings in Portland?

Answer: Current trends favor minimalist designs, natural materials, and neutral color palettes. This translates to a demand for quartz countertops, shaker-style cabinets in muted tones, and brushed nickel or matte black hardware. Sustainable materials, such as reclaimed wood and recycled glass, are also gaining popularity.
